On Tue, May 07, 2019 at 02:07:30PM +0200, Sebastian Reichel wrote:

> FWIW, I send out kernel.org mails via mail.kernel.org. Konstantin
> added that service in 2014. You can get a password with

> ssh git@gitolite.kernel.org getsmtppass
> 
> and then use the following settings for (example for git):

I'd have to send all mail out via kernel.org to do that, or persuade a
MTA to route mail differently based on contents which seems interesting
- I inject most of my mail via /usr/sbin/sendmail rather than SMTP
(including a bunch of scripts).
